Subject: Re: [PATCH treewide 2/5] clk: visconti: Make sure clk_init_data is fully initialized

> The clk_init_data structure contains several mutually-exclusive members
> for different methods to specify the possible parents of a clock,
> prompting drivers to initialize only the members they need. However,
> not initializing all members may cause subtle issues, which are only
> exposed when CONFIG_INIT_STACK_ALL_PATTERN or CONFIG_INIT_STACK_NONE is
> enabled.
>
> visconti_clk_register_gate() fills in init.parent_data, and assumes that
> init.parent_names is NULL. However, the latter in uninitialized, and
> thus may cause a crash.
>
> Make sure all members are fully initialized, to fix such bugs, and to
> avoid future breakage when converting drivers to a different method for
> specifying the parents.
